Shelf Life 24 Months What is sodium sulphate? Sodium sulfate, also known as sulfate of soda, is the inorganic compound with formula Na2SO4 as well as several related hydrates. All forms are white solids that are highly soluble in water. With an annual production of 6 million tonnes, the decahydrate is a major commodity chemical product. It is mainly used for the manufacture of detergents and in the kraft process of paper pulping. Function of sodium sulphate Used as materials for synthetic detergent, glass, papermaking, inorganic salts, dyestuff, alcohol fibre, tanning, metal smelting, surface treatment and filler industries etc. Application of sodium sulphate Sodium sulfate Anhydrous is consumed in four major categories; powder detergents as a processing aid and as a filler, wood pulp processing for making kraft paper, textile dyeing processes as a levelling agent to penetrate evenly, and molten glass process to remove small air bubbles. Rubber industry Stearic acid plays an important role in the synthesis and processing of rubber. Stearic acid is a vulcanizing active agent widely used in natural gums, synthetic rubber and latex, and can also be used as a plasticizer and softener. In the production of synthetic rubber process need to add stearic acid as emulsifier, in the manufacture of foam rubber, stearic acid can be used as a foaming agent, stearic acid can also be used as rubber products release agent. Cosmetics industry Stearic acid is used to emulsify two types of skin care products, such as cream and cold cream, so that it becomes a stable white paste. Stearic acid is also the main raw material for making almond honey and milk. Stearic acid soap esters are more widely used in cosmetics industry.
Calcium Hypochlorite for disinfection of water ITEM CAL-HYPO 65%min CAL-HYPO 70%min Available Chlorine % 65min 70min Water % 5.5-10 5.5-10 Granule Size (14-50mesh)% 90min 90min Calcium hypochlorite exists as a white granular powder and has the formula of Ca(OCl)2. It has a strong scent of chlorine but is more stable than chlorine. It exists as both anhydrous and hydrated forms, giving a basic aqueous solution. The basicity of the solution arises from the hydrolysis reaction, where calcium hypochlorite is broken down into hypochlorous acid and calcium hydroxide. The basicity outweighs the acidity property since calcium hydroxide is a strong base and hypochlorous acid is a weak acid. Calcium hypochlorite is a good chlorine derivative and can release chlorine upon reactions. Calcium hypochlorite can react with carbon dioxide to form calcium carbonate, releasing dichloride monoxide. Similarly, calcium hypochlorite can also react with hydrochloric acid to form calcium chloride, water and gaseous chlorineIt is a solid substitute for liquid sodium hypochlorite for water treatment and bleaching. Calcium hypochlorite is a versatile chemical that finds its application in various industries. Some of its major applications are: 1. Deodorant: Calcium hypochlorite is used as a deodorant due to its strong oxidizing properties. It can react with the odor-causing compounds and neutralize them, thereby eliminating the foul smell. 2. Oxidizing agent: Calcium hypochlorite is a potent oxidizing agent and finds its use in various chemical reactions. It can oxidize a wide range of organic compounds, including alcohols, aldehydes, and ketones. 3. Bleaching agent: Calcium hypochlorite is commonly used as a bleaching agent in the textile and paper industries. It can remove the color from the fibers and make them white. 4. Swimming pool sanitation: Calcium hypochlorite is widely used for swimming pool sanitation. It can effectively kill the bacteria and other microorganisms present in the water and keep it clean and safe for swimming. 5. Water treatment: Calcium hypochlorite is used to disinfect drinking water and other industrial water sources. It can kill the harmful pathogens and make the water safe for consumption. 6. Bathroom cleaners and laundry detergents: Calcium hypochlorite is used in various cleaning products, such as bathroom cleaners and laundry detergents, due to its strong oxidizing properties. It can remove the tough stains and dirt from the surfaces and fabrics. 7. Haloform reaction: Calcium hypochlorite plays an important role in the haloform reaction to prepare chloroform. In this reaction, it reacts with acetone or ethanol to produce chloroform. In summary, calcium hypochlorite is a useful chemical with a wide range of applications in various industries. Its strong oxidizing and disinfecting properties make it a popular choice for water treatment, sanitation, and cleaning products.

Product name: Potassium sorbate CBnumber: CB3294185 CAS: 590-00-1 EINECS Number: 611-771-3 Physical characteristics Colorless to white scaly crystals or crystalline powders, odorless or slightly odorous. Unstable in air. It can be colored by oxidation. Molecular weight 150.22. It is hygroscopic. Soluble in water and ethanol. Production method The neutralization method is mainly used. It is obtained by neutralizing sorbic acid with potassium carbonate or potassium hydroxide. Potassium sorbate is made of sorbate and potassium carbonate as raw materials, because the production technology is simple, only one step reaction, can complete the key process, so many small business owners, as long as a little learning, can master this technology, which is also an important reason for the increasing number of small potassium sorbate production enterprises. Due to the simple production facilities of many small enterprises, most of them have only a few houses, a reactor, a blender, several manual sealing machines and other facilities, the lack of purification devices, and manual production, so the production cost is low, but the physical and chemical quality and health quality of the products are often unstable. Scope of use At present, it has been widely used in food, beverage, pickles, tobacco, medicine, cosmetics, agricultural products, feed and other industries, from the development trend, its application scope is still expanding. Sorbate (potassium) is an acidic preservative, and it still has a good preservative effect in foods that are close to neutral (PH6.0-6.5), while the preservative effect of benzoic acid (sodium) is in PH> At 4, the effect has been significantly reduced, and there is bad taste. Cosmetic preservatives. It is an organic acid preservative. The addition amount is generally 0.5%. Can be mixed with sorbic acid. Although potassium sorbate is easily soluble in water and easy to use, the pH value of its 1% aqueous solution is 7-8, which has the tendency to increase the pH value of cosmetics, and should be paid attention to when using.

ithium carbonate ,an inorganic compound ,is stable in the air .It is slightly soluble in water and soluble in dilute acid . appearance :white powder MF :Li2CO3 MW:73.89 Melting point :720�ºC boiling point :1342�ºC density :2.11g/ml impurity factory standard(â?¤%) Na 0.0005 Mg 0.0005 Al 0.0003 K 0.0005 Ca 0.0001 Fe 0.0003 Zn 0.0003 Si 0.0005 SO4 0.0005 Cd 0.0005 Pb 0.0001 Ni 0.0001 Mn 0.0001 Cu 0.0001 Co 0.0001 Cr 0.0001 Application Industrial lithium carbonate is used in the manufacture of other lithium salts, such as lithium chloride and lithium bromide and so on. It also acts as lithium oxide materials in enamel, glass, pottery and porcelain enamel, and it is also added to the electrolytic cell for electrolysis of aluminum to increase the current efficiency and reduce the internal resistance of the cell and the bath temperature.Battery grade lithium carbonate is mainly used for the preparation of lithium cobalt oxide, lithium manganese oxide, ternary materials, lithium iron phosphate and other lithium ion battery cathode materials .

Acetylated Distarch Glycerol is prepared by treating starch with acetic acid anhydride and glycerol. This results in a starch that is resistant against stirring and high temperatures and with a high stability after cooling. They are prepared by physically, enzymatically, or chemically treating native starch, thereby changing the properties of the starch. Modified starches are used in practically all starch applications, such as in food products as a thickening agent, stabilizer or emulsifier; in pharmaceuticals as a disintegrant; as binder in coated paper.
